Robert Bush, a funeral director at Hull-based Legacy Independent Funeral Directors, has been described as "callous, cold and calculated" by one grieving man after admitting 67 offences spanning 12 years and affecting hundreds of victims.
A stillborn baby was left in an envelope on the floor of his premises for nearly two years while his mother believed he had been given a funeral and cremated. Other families were handed the wrong ashes as the bodies of those they loved were left decomposing on shelves.

Jade's Law Campaign
Jo Early and her daughter Abi know the damage caused when a parent convicted of harming their child retains automatic rights. Gavin Gibbs was convicted of breaking baby Charlie’s arm, yet remained legally entitled to contact sister Abi for years through cards, gifts and messages. That contact confused, unsettled and prolonged the pain. Jade’s Law rightly removes parental rights from those convicted of killing a child. The same principle should apply where a parent has inflicted serious violence. Jo’s campaign deserves support.
